roboforum.ru

Технический форум по робототехнике.

AVR Studio - вопросы и ответы

Re: AVR Studio - вопросы и ответы

sarkel39 » 18 фев 2010, 11:17

Добрый всем день!Все материалы по AVR программатору dв журнале Радио2006-5 и текст этой статьи в обсуждении этого вопроса (смотри выше).На сайте журнала эту статью можно прочитать лишь в виде аннотации,а полностью только в "живую".Для своих нужд изготовил кроме AVR-программатора, программатор EXTRA PIC под управлением
IC prog.
Теперь все работает отлично!Рекомендую .Для повторения программаторов все доступно и не дорого.
Успеха всем вам!

Re: AVR Studio - вопросы и ответы

avr123.nm.ru » 18 фев 2010, 13:38

топик про AVR Studio - вы как увязываете с этим свой пост ???

Re: AVR Studio - вопросы и ответы

sarkel39 » 19 фев 2010, 12:40

Извините не понял сути вопроса.Если это касается моей подписи, то я желаю всем шагать по жизни с таким постом(если я правильно понял вопрос).Нам всем легче будет общатся не только на нашем форуме!

Re: AVR Studio - вопросы и ответы

bloodaxe » 22 мар 2010, 21:45

Всем привет. Можно ли прогледеть в авр студио значение переменных? Если да, так чё и как делать?

Re: AVR Studio - вопросы и ответы

avr123.nm.ru » 22 мар 2010, 21:56

В паузе на переменную мышку навести - всплывет. и наверно окно watch

Re: AVR Studio - вопросы и ответы

bloodaxe » 22 мар 2010, 22:04

Чё значит в паузе? Т.е надо както запустить симулятор? У меня error показует при запуске симулятора.

Re: AVR Studio - вопросы и ответы

galex1981 » 22 мар 2010, 22:13

Если показывает ошибку, то должна быть расшифровка ошибки

Re: AVR Studio - вопросы и ответы

tsrodger » 22 мар 2010, 22:29

bloodaxe писал(а):Т.е надо както запустить симулятор? У меня error показует при запуске симулятора.

Запуск отладки: Debug -> Start Debugging или Ctrl+Shift+Alt+F5

Для корректной работы отладки должна быть выбрана соответствующая платформа и МК в Debug -> Select Platform & Device
Если нет аппаратных решений (типа AVR Dragon), то это или AVR Simulator, или AVR Simulator 2 и, конечно, выбранный вами МК...

Re: AVR Studio - вопросы и ответы

bloodaxe » 22 мар 2010, 23:04

Выбрал AvrSimuliator. А куда и как правельно вводить название переменных в окне watch?

Re: AVR Studio - вопросы и ответы

avr123.nm.ru » 22 мар 2010, 23:28

Попробуйте драг-н-дроп - мышкой туда перетянуть из текста исходника.

Re: AVR Studio - вопросы и ответы

tsrodger » 22 мар 2010, 23:53

1) запустите отладку, выделите переменную, правой кнопкой мыши Add watch
2) запустите отладку, нажмите Alt+1, в появившемся окне правой кнопкой мыши Add Item...

Re: AVR Studio - вопросы и ответы

bloodaxe » 23 мар 2010, 00:03

Хочу погледеть чё находится в регистре ADCH, когда перетаскиваю ADCH в окно watch, пишет-Not in scope. С другими переменными тоже самое, или же пишет-Location not valid.

Re: AVR Studio - вопросы и ответы

tsrodger » 23 мар 2010, 00:16

Для того чтобы посмотреть регистры и биты регистров есть Toolbar под названием I/O View (вызов Alt+5): там интуитивно понятное дерево со всеми регистрами и битами выбранного МК с описанием. ADCH относится к АЦП, поэтому откройте дерево AD_CONVERTER в I/O View

Re: AVR Studio - вопросы и ответы

bloodaxe » 23 мар 2010, 00:36

Спасибо за ответ. А как быть с переменными? Пишет-Location not valid.

Re: AVR Studio - вопросы и ответы

tsrodger » 23 мар 2010, 01:01

Честно говоря не припоминаю такой ошибки, но я не часто работаю в студии. Если верить гуглу: попробуйте выставить оптимизацию -O0 (Project - > Configuration option -> General -> Optimization -> O0)

Другие варианты в гугле


Rambler\'s Top100 Mail.ru counter